3 minutes ago, Alastor said:

I didn't know about that fact. Was it directly because of the film? 

It directly relates to the representation of Rain Man spreading common misconceptions like all autistics being savants (when only a small percentage are), and it spreads the lie that all savants are autistic (which also isn't the case). Thus spreading the media culture we have now where autism = savantism. Basically it indirectly created conditions for inaccurate representation of the community. Maybe it's not directly because of the film, but it definitely has a role to play in that problem in modern media.
